Article Overview
LOS in an optical module stands for "Loss of Signal," indicating that the receiver is not detecting sufficient optical power to establish a valid link.
Definition and Function
In optical modules, LOS (Loss of Signal) is a diagnostic indicator used to monitor the optical receiver (RX). When LOS is asserted, it means the module's receiver is not receiving enough light to maintain a reliable communication link, effectively signaling that the optical signal is too weak or absent . This can occur due to fiber breaks, excessive bending, contamination, long-distance attenuation, or mismatched optics .
How LOS Works
Optical modules typically include a photodetector that converts incoming optical signals into electrical signals. The module continuously monitors the received optical power, and if it falls below a predefined sensitivity threshold, the LOS signal is triggered . The LOS output is usually a digital signal (high or low) that informs the host system of the link status. When LOS is active, the host device may shut down the port or mark the link as down, preventing higher-layer protocols from attempting communication over a faulty link .
Importance in Network Maintenance
Monitoring LOS is crucial for network reliability and troubleshooting. By observing LOS signals, engineers can quickly determine whether a link failure is due to the optical module, the fiber connection, or the remote device. This helps in preventing prolonged downtime and maintaining stable network performance .
Summary
LOS is a key safety and diagnostic feature in optical modules, ensuring that insufficient optical signals are detected promptly. It allows network systems to respond to signal loss, maintain data integrity, and facilitate efficient troubleshooting in fiber-optic communication systems .
